在当今科技飞速发展的时代,物联网技术逐渐普及,其中掌控板(Arduino)作为一种开源硬件平台,因其易用性和灵活性而受到许多爱好者和开发者的青睐。本文将详细介绍如何使用掌控板轻松操控电脑角色,帮助你将创意变为现实。
掌控板简介
掌控板(Arduino)是一款基于ATmega328P微控制器的开源硬件平台,它可以通过编程来控制各种外部设备,如电机、传感器等。通过简单的编程语言,用户可以轻松实现各种创意项目。
操控电脑角色的准备工作
1. 准备材料
- 掌控板(Arduino Uno或其他型号)
- USB线
- 电脑
- 掌控板开发环境(如Arduino IDE)
- 电脑角色控制软件(如鼠标、键盘模拟软件)
2. 安装驱动程序
确保你的电脑已经安装了Arduino IDE,并正确安装了掌控板的驱动程序。
3. 编写控制代码
在Arduino IDE中,编写以下代码,用于控制电脑角色:
// 控制鼠标
void setup() {
Serial.begin(9600);
}
void loop() {
// 向电脑发送鼠标移动指令
Serial.print("M100,100\n");
delay(1000); // 延时1秒
}
4. 编写电脑角色控制脚本
在电脑上安装鼠标、键盘模拟软件,并编写相应的控制脚本。以下是一个简单的Python脚本示例,用于模拟鼠标点击:
import pyautogui
import time
# 模拟鼠标点击
pyautogui.click(x=100, y=100)
time.sleep(1)
编程实现
1. 控制鼠标
将掌控板连接到电脑,并在Arduino IDE中上传控制鼠标的代码。此时,掌控板将开始发送鼠标移动指令到电脑。
2. 运行电脑角色控制脚本
在电脑上运行鼠标控制脚本,模拟鼠标点击。此时,电脑角色将按照脚本进行操作。
总结
通过以上步骤,你可以轻松使用掌控板操控电脑角色。在实际应用中,你可以根据需求扩展控制功能,如控制键盘、麦克风等。此外,掌控板还可以与其他传感器、执行器等硬件结合,实现更多创意项目。希望本文能帮助你开启掌控板的无限可能。
